Ice melts are often made with sodium chloride, potassium chloride, and/or magnesium chloride, which can cause a severe increase in the bodys sodium levels. The name picaridin was proposed as an International Nonproprietary Name (INN) to the World Health Organization (WHO), but the official name that has been approved by the WHO is icaridin. Toxicity can occur due to the overuse, misuse, or use of multiple cholinesterase-inhibiting insecticides; overexposure to insecticides in the surrounding home environment; the misuse of organophosphate insecticides in cats (e.g., organophosphate-containing dips labeled for dogs only, inappropriately applied to cats); or the intentional application of house or yard insecticides on cats. q@yhc#k u7Bu; ! Poisons, also called toxins, are substances that have an adverse effect on the body, even a very mild effect.
